1. Tanaka TCH22EBP2 21cc 2-Cycle Gas Hedge Trimmer
Review
The Tanaka TCH22EBP2 21cc 2-Cycle Gas Hedge Trimmer is a gas-powered 21cc model, and it has a 2-cycle engine, so you can rest assured that it provides constant and reliable power, and it has a lot of power to mash its way through some pretty tough hedges.
The blades are 3-faced with a two-way design, with fairly large spacing, so they should be able to handle even the thickest of hedges with ease, plus the cutting speed is very fast as well. Moreover, this item is an all-around durable and high-quality gas-powered hedge trimmer designed for big jobs. With that being said, it does weigh close to 17 pounds, so it’s definitely not a lightweight option, which can be a problem if you have to use it all day.

2. Poulan Pro PR2322 Dual Sided Hedge Trimmer
Review
Something that can be said about the Poulan Pro PR2322 Dual Sided Hedge Trimmer is that it is fairly lightweight. It comes in at around 11 pounds, plus it also has ergonomic and comfortably designed handles. Therefore, it is a good option to go with continuous use, one that should not cause too much fatigue. The fact that it’s designed to minimize vibrations definitely doesn’t hurt either.
The Poulan Pro PR2322 Dual Sided Hedge Trimmer is a 23cc 2-cycle gas-powered trimmer, so it has more than enough power to eat its way through some pretty dense and tough hedges. It can handle branches up to 1 inch in diameter. We can also say that the steel blades are of very high quality.

3. Husqvarna 122HD45 Gas Hedge Trimmer
Review
The Husqvarna 122HD45 Gas Hedge Trimmer weighs roughly 12 pounds, which makes it a fairly lightweight option. Moreover, it is designed to reduce both noise and vibration, plus it also has a multi-position handle with a good grip pattern. All of these features come together to make this particular hedge trimmer quite easy and comfortable to use.
It is advertised as starting easily with the pull cord, but there have been some complaints that it takes excessive pulling to get it started. On the other hand, the Husqvarna 122HD45 Gas Hedge Trimmer does have a powerful 21.77cc 2 cycle gas engine, so it does have more than enough power to work its way through some pretty tough hedges, plus the blade length is ideal for cutting large swathes at once.

4. Husqvarna 122HD60 Dual Action Hedge Trimmer
Review
So, the main difference between the Husqvarna 122HD60 Dual Action Hedge Trimmer and the other model from the same brand is the length. This one has blades nearly 24 inches long, whereas the previous model’s blades were 18 inches. This means that you can cut a whole lot more at once for a much faster result. Other than that, both models are more or less identical.
Yes, this one is a bit heavier due to its larger size, and it weighs over 16 pounds, so it’s not exactly lightweight. However, it does still have a comfortable multi-position grip, and it is designed to keep vibrations to a minimum. The cutting diameter of the blades, as well as the engine power, is the same as with the previous Husqvarna trimmer.

5. Echo HC-152 Gas Powered Hedge Trimmer
Review
The Echo HC-152 Gas Powered Hedge Trimmer has a very lightweight design, as it comes in at just over 11 pounds, plus it has an ergonomically designed handle with multiple gripping positions and a soft coating, not to mention that the rigid control bar allows for really precise hedge trimming. In other words, the Echo HC-152 Gas Powered Hedge Trimmer is quite easy and comfortable to use.
What can also be said about the Echo HC-152 Gas Powered Hedge Trimmer is that it is built with some very high-quality components, and it does have a fairly powerful 21.2 cc 2 cycle gas engine, so it should be more than powerful enough to get most jobs done with ease. That being said, the pull cord can be a bit of a pain to master.
